In the case of the murder of Peggy has appealed the public Prosecutor of Bayreuth on Monday, according to information complaint against the release of the suspects. The 41-year-old man was left on Christmas eve after a decision of the district court of Bayreuth. According to the office of the Prosecutor of the arrest warrant. “There is an urgent suspicion against the accused is on,” informed the Prosecutor’s office. The district court will examine the arguments, and the files, where appropriate, of the County court of Bayreuth to the decision to submit.

The attorney of the from the upper Franconian district of Wunsiedel-born man had lodged a complaint against Detention. The district court denied a probable cause against the 41-Year-old, among other things, because he had to call his part-confession, and this could no longer be used against him. The man came free.

The nine-year-old Peggy was on 7. May 2001 on the way home from school disappeared. In July 2016, and parts of her skeleton were found in a forest in Rodach Brunn in the Thuringian Saale-Orla-Kreis, nearly 20 kilometers from Peggy’s hometown of Lichtenberg in upper Franconia. (dpa)
